Since the publication of our first book book ""Vaccine Design: Innovative Approaches and Novel Strategies"" in 2011, the field of vaccinology has advanced significantly. The application of new sophisticated 'omics' technologies and the use of pioneering approaches have yielded a wealth of new data. This new book aims to distill the most important new findings to provide a timely overview of the field.
